Calais Trails Commitee Meeting

Past event
Oct 24, 2015, 9 to 11 AM

The Calais Trails Committee will meet on Saturday, October 24, 9 AM, at the Curtis Pond State Fishing Access, on Worcester Rd. The meeting will convene to discuss the formal adoption of the "Bradley Loop", a half-mile trail near the west end of Longmeadow Hill Rd, running south from the existing "Ellis-Bruce" Trail. The meeting will then adjourn, while we walk portions of two nearby trail routes that could connect Curtis Pond directly to the existing "Robinson Ridge Trail". We will re-convene the meeting at the end of this walk to evaluate and possibly make some decisions regarding adoption of some or all of these connecting trails. This is a public meeting; anyone interested is encouraged to attend. Waterproof footwear recommended. For additional information, call Reed Cherington at 223-5427.
